Episode Summary:
Reema speaks with Zulma Beatriz Williams, a mental health therapist and motivational speaker, about her inspiring journey from Buenos Aires to the U.S., her battle with breast cancer, and her transformative approach to therapy. Zulma shares how life’s challenges shaped her perspective, emphasizing the power of vulnerability and resilience in personal growth.
About the Guest:
Zulma Beatriz Williams is a mental health therapist, trauma specialist, and breast cancer survivor who overcame numerous challenges to transform her life and inspire others. A certified Accelerated Resolution Therapy (ART) practitioner, Zulma integrates techniques like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) to help clients heal and grow. Starting her education at age 42 and graduating with a master’s degree at 50, Zulma’s story is a testament to perseverance and self-discovery. Key Takeaways:
- Resilience Through Adversity: Zulma shares her journey of overcoming socioeconomic challenges, battling breast cancer, and recovering from abusive relationships, demonstrating the power of perseverance.
- Transforming Challenges Into Opportunities: Life’s hardships can serve as stepping stones to personal growth if approached with the right mindset.
- Authentic Therapy Practices: Techniques like ART and CBT can help clients process trauma and reframe negative thoughts effectively.
- The Role of Vulnerability: Vulnerability is essential for healing, personal growth, and building genuine connections.
- Empowering Life Lessons: Learn to move away from a victim mentality by recognizing your resilience and embracing opportunities for growth.
